Output 43b20f668f5b16e82fba3b1e8d824da1bde95e3920185add3b64a7a8653f354d:0

value
2591887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a916e8c8dd572c8079d0c576d0f847689dfaa90e OP_EQUAL
address
3H75ZjJf34o4JeBWWBzX4UR5baQiLUC8wX
transaction
43b20f668f5b16e82fba3b1e8d824da1bde95e3920185add3b64a7a8653f354d
confirmations
238868
spent
true